NLSX4402
2-Bit 20 Mb/s Dual-Supply
Level Translator
The NLSX4402 is a 2−bit configurable dual−supply bidirectional
auto sensing translator that does not require a directional control pin.
The VCC I/O and VL I/O ports are designed to track two different
power supply rails, VCC and VL respectively. Both the VCC and VL
supply rails are configurable from 1.5 V to 5.5 V. This allows voltage
logic signals on the VL side to be translated into lower, higher or
equal value voltage logic signals on the VCC side, and vice−versa.
The NLSX4402 translator has internal pull−up resistors on the I/O
lines. The pull−up resistors are used to pull up the I/O lines to either
VL or VCC. The NLSX4402 is an excellent match for open−drain
applications such as the I2C communication bus.

APPLICATIONS INFORMATION
Level Translator Architecture
parameters listed in the data sheet assume that the output
impedance of the drivers connected to the translator is less
than 50 kW.
The NLSX4402 auto sense translator provides
bi−directional voltage level shifting to transfer data in
multiple supply voltage systems. This device has two
supply voltages, VL and VCC, which set the logic levels on
the input and output sides of the translator. When used to
transfer data from the VL to the VCC ports, input signals
referenced to the VL supply are translated to output signals
with a logic level matched to VCC. In a similar manner, the
VCC to VL translation shifts input signals with a logic level
compatible to VCC to an output signal matched to VL.
The NLSX4402 consists of two bi−directional channels
that independently determine the direction of the data flow
without requiring a directional pin. The one−shot circuits
are used to detect the rising or falling input signals. In
addition, the one shots decrease the rise and fall time of the
output signal for high−to−low and low−to−high transitions.
Each input/output channel has an internal 10 kW pull.
The magnitude of the pullup resistors can be reduced by
connecting external resistors in parallel to the internal
10 kW resistors.
Enable Input (EN)
The NLSX4402 has an Enable pin (EN) that provides
tri−state operation at the I/O pins. Driving the Enable pin
to a low logic level minimizes the power consumption of
the device and drives the I/O VCC and I/O VL pins to a high
impedance state. Normal translation operation occurs
when the EN pin is equal to a logic high signal. The EN pin
is referenced to the VL supply and has Overvoltage
Tolerant (OVT) protection.
Power Supply Guidelines
During normal operation, supply voltage VL can be
greater than, less than or equal to VCC. The sequencing of
the power supplies will not damage the device during the
power up operation.
For optimal performance, 0.01 mF to 0.1 mF decoupling
capacitors should be used on the VL and VCC power supply
pins. Ceramic capacitors are a good design choice to filter
and bypass any noise signals on the voltage lines to the
ground plane of the PCB. The noise immunity will be
maximized by placing the capacitors as close as possible to
the supply and ground pins, along with minimizing the
PCB connection traces.
Input Driver Requirements
The rise (tR) and fall (tF) timing parameters of the open
drain outputs depend on the magnitude of the pull−up
resistors. In addition, the propagation times (tPD), skew
(tPSKEW) and maximum data rate depend on the impedance
of the device that is connected to the translator. The timing
